Hello Shilpa,If you have Masters' degree in History and Hindi both, then it depens upon you and your interest. Because, according to NET exam eligibility criteria, you can select the subject for the exam in which you have done the Masters and you should have minimum 55% aggregate marks. For reserved category aspirants, NTA provides the relaxation of 5% in aggregate marks.

If you are interested in networking, you need to pursue courses like CCNA. Because, BCA focuses more on computer applications alone as opposed to networking. If you have a good foundation in networking you can get a certification and get started immediately. A certificate from a good organization adds a lot of weight to your career. Or an alternative would be to pursue a career in CS applications, testing coding and try to move internally into the networking department in a year or two.

Last year, the cut-off was 86.5 percentile. Your admission will depend upon your overall score in SNAP, GE-Pi-WAT process based on the following breakup:
SNAP score out of 150 scaled down to 50
GE - 10
Pi - 30
WAT - 10
_
Total - 100
